How many rows does a Boeing 737-900 have?

How many rows does a Boeing 737-900 have?

The Main Cabin includes a total of 162 seats in rows 6-34, including 24 Premium Class seats in rows 6-9. Exit row seating on this aircraft is in rows 16 and 17.

What is a 737-900 winglet?

These winglets are a piece of standard equipment on BBJ (Boeing Business Jets) since 2000 and retrofitted (optional) on the 737-300, 737-500, 737-700, 737-800, and 737-900 Extended Range (ER), 757-200/-300, and 767-300ER aeroplanes. How far can a Boeing 737-900 fly?

The 737 became the first commercial jet airplane to surpass the 10,000 orders milestone in July 2012 thanks to United Airlines order of 100 737 MAX 9s and 50 Next-Generation 737-900ERs (Extended Range) aircraft. The 737-900ER has a flight range of 2,870 miles (4,587 km).

How many seats does a United 737 900 have?

There are no USB ports on this plane. The economy cabins on the 737-900s have 159 seats arranged in a 3×3 configuration. Seats are 17 inches wide with 30-31 inches of pitch. Within the economy cabin, there are 42 seats with 4 inches of extra legroom which United brands “Economy Plus”.
